Side-by-Side Comparison

Feature ausgraben ausrauben
Definition mit einem Werkzeug (wie Schaufel oder dergleichen) oder mit den Händen aus dem Erdreich holen jemandem alles wegnehmen; etwas vollständig (von Wertvollem) leeren

Spelling & Dictionary Insight

A purely visual mix-up. ausgraben ([ˈaʊ̯sˌɡʁaːbn̩]) and ausrauben ([ˈaʊ̯sˌʁaʊ̯bn̩])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one. On the page they stay close: they share most of their letters but differ in 3 positions.
